The elite angler possesses a multifaceted skill set. Basic knowledge is merely the foundation; true mastery demands a deeper understanding of fish behavior, hydrology, and meteorology. This begins with identifying target species and thoroughly researching their habits. What are their preferred habitats? What's their diet? What triggers their feeding frenzies? Understanding these nuances is crucial to consistently finding and catching your quarry. For instance, understanding the subtle differences in water temperature and current flow can mean the difference between a blank day and a memorable catch. Similarly, knowledge of seasonal migrations, spawning behaviors, and the impact of weather patterns on fish activity are all invaluable tools in the elite angler’s arsenal.
Beyond biological understanding, the elite angler is a master of technique. This extends far beyond simply casting a line. It encompasses a deep understanding of various fishing methods, from fly fishing’s delicate artistry to the powerful precision of spin casting and the patient finesse of bait fishing. Each method demands unique skills and adaptations. Fly fishing, for example, requires an intimate understanding of fly selection, line control, and the subtle art of presentation. The fly must mimic the natural food source perfectly, and the presentation must be flawless to avoid spooking a wary trout. Spin casting, on the other hand, requires a strong and accurate cast to reach distant targets, often in challenging conditions. Mastering these diverse techniques allows the elite angler to adapt to any environment and target a wide array of species.
Equipment plays a crucial role in elite angling. It’s not just about owning the most expensive gear; it’s about understanding the purpose and capabilities of each piece of equipment and selecting the right tools for the job. This involves careful consideration of rod action, reel type, line weight, and lure or fly selection, all tailored to the specific target species and fishing conditions. An elite angler understands the nuances of different rod actions – fast, medium-fast, medium, and slow – and selects the appropriate action for the intended technique and target species. Similarly, choosing the right reel, with the proper drag system and line capacity, is crucial for handling powerful fish. The selection of line, whether braided, monofilament, or fluorocarbon, is equally important, considering its strength, visibility, and abrasion resistance.
Beyond the technical aspects, elite outdoor angling involves a deep respect for the environment. This means practicing responsible catch-and-release techniques, minimizing environmental impact, and adhering to all regulations and ethical guidelines. Understanding the delicate balance of the ecosystem is paramount. Knowing when to release a fish to protect its health and reproductive capabilities is just as important as knowing how to catch it. Elite anglers understand that responsible fishing practices contribute to the sustainability of fish populations and the preservation of pristine waterways. They leave no trace, pack out all their trash, and strive to minimize any disturbance to the natural habitat.
